It does vary from person to person.  For many it's feeling trapped, like in a car, or the corner of a restaurant.  For some it's being in open places (like the mall or grocery store)where the fear of embarassment of having a panic attack overwhelms you and as a result....you have a panic attack. As scary as they are...they are harmless, so know that nothing bad will happen.  Mine was while driving and losing control while driving with my kids in the car. I hope this helps and take care.

Anything you can imagine can trigger an anxiety attack...........for someone. What triggers YOURS is something you must discover on your own.
If you are having anxiety attacks, think about WHERE and WHEN you've had them.
If you've had several at the Mall, then you know SOMETHING about the Mall is a trigger. You then need to figure out exactly what that trigger is. Some people have very specific triggers, like public speaking. They know if they have to get up and speak in front of a crowd, they will have an anxiety attack. People who have very specific, and therefore, known triggers, are "lucky" in some ways. They know exactly what they need to work on to overcome their anxiety. For the rest of us who apparently have anxiety for no reason, we are the ones in the leaky canoe. But there is ALWAYS a reason for our anxiety. We just have to work a bit harder to figure out what the root cause of our anxiety is and learn to deal with it. This is usually done through therapy and often a combination of therapy plus medication.
